fanxiang S101 1TB vs S101Q 4TB SATA SSD Comparison

The fanxiang S101 1TB and S101Q 4TB are 2.5-inch SATA SSDs intended to replace slower hard drives in compatible computers. The S101 is the stronger overall, speed, and value choice in the supplied scores, while the S101Q is the capacity-led option with 4TB and a broader stated feature set. Reliability feedback is mixed for both, with added caution warranted around the S101Q 4TB review reports.

Detailed comparison

Performance

The S101 has the advantage in the supplied performance and speed scores and is listed with faster peak read performance. Reviews for it describe noticeably faster boots, responsive applications, and quicker large-file transfers after replacing an HDD. The S101Q is still positioned as a clear HDD upgrade, and reviewers describe fast results in older systems, but its lower performance score and reported 4TB stability concerns make it the less certain performance choice for important workloads.

Speed

The S101 wins on stated peak speed: its supplied information lists up to 550MB/s read and 520MB/s write, compared with up to 500MB/s read and 470MB/s write for the S101Q. It also has the stronger speed score. Either drive should feel much faster than an HDD in a compatible system, but the S101 is the more logical pick when peak SATA transfer performance is the priority.

Reliability

Neither drive has unqualified reliability feedback. For the S101, reviewers and the supplied interpretation cite some failures and computer-recognition issues. For the S101Q, many users report normal operation, but some report early failures; one detailed 4TB review alleged inconsistent capacity reporting, disappearing drives, and unstable write behaviour. The S101Q's slightly higher reliability score does not outweigh the seriousness of that specific 4TB complaint for critical data use.

Frequently asked questions

Which is better overall: the fanxiang S101 1TB or S101Q 4TB?

The fanxiang S101 1TB is the stronger overall choice in the supplied scoring, helped by higher performance, speed, value, and customer-satisfaction results. The S101Q 4TB is the more appropriate choice only when its much larger capacity and its stated drive-management features are more important than the S101's stronger overall balance.

Which fanxiang SATA SSD has more storage?

The S101Q provides 4TB, compared with 1TB for the S101. That makes the S101Q the clear capacity option for large collections of files. However, the supplied review data includes a detailed 4TB complaint about inconsistent reported capacity, so buyers should verify the drive promptly and keep important data backed up.

Which drive is faster, the S101 1TB or S101Q 4TB?

On the listed specifications, the S101 1TB has the advantage in peak read speed at up to 550MB/s, while the S101Q is listed at up to 500MB/s read and 470MB/s write. The S101 also has higher performance and speed scores. Both are positioned as substantial upgrades from a mechanical HDD.

Are these SSDs easy to install?

Both drives use the familiar 2.5-inch SATA format, and reviewers commonly describe installation as straightforward. The S101Q has the stronger setup score, while the S101 also receives positive installation feedback. Before ordering, confirm that the device accepts a 2.5-inch SATA drive rather than an M.2 or NVMe SSD.

Which SSD is better for an older laptop or desktop?

Either model can suit a compatible older system moving from a hard drive to SATA SSD storage. Choose the S101 1TB for a more balanced, higher-scoring everyday upgrade. Choose the S101Q when 4TB is genuinely needed, but validate capacity and stability during the return period because the supplied feedback raises concerns for the 4TB variant.

Which fanxiang SSD is better for important files?

Neither drive should be the sole location for irreplaceable files, since both products have mixed reliability feedback. The S101Q 4TB deserves additional caution because one detailed review alleged capacity-reporting and stability issues. Maintain separate backups regardless of which SSD you select, and test detection, formatting, and sustained transfers after installation.

Do the S101 and S101Q work with Mac, Windows, and Linux?

The supplied product information for both drives lists Windows, Linux, and Mac OS compatibility. Actual use still depends on having a compatible SATA connection, drive bay, cable, or enclosure. The S101 has some recognition-related feedback, so if it is not detected, checking the adapter, BIOS or UEFI settings, and formatting configuration is sensible.
